Ba2FeGe is an intermetallic compound combining barium, iron, and germanium in a defined stoichiometric ratio. This is a research-phase material studied primarily for its electronic and magnetic properties rather than established engineering applications. The compound represents exploration within the broader family of ternary intermetallics, where layered crystal structures and mixed-metal bonding can produce novel functional behaviors such as unusual electronic transport or magnetic interactions.
